Trading Game

“The Pandemonium Trading Game” is based on the financing, mining and distribution of a fictional metal, Pandemonium.  There are few rules and success requires little more than energy, enthusiasm, a basic idea of how supply and demand influence price and most importantly of all, an ability to take risk and strike bargains.  It is hosted by Paul Anderson (OL91) an alum of Leeds Grammar School who was a senior manager from Deutsche Bank’s Fixed Income and Currencies division and promises 90 minutes of educational mayhem.

This fun, lively and interactive session runs across both periods 3 and 4.

Profile of panelists

Paul Anderson
Paul Anderson left LGS in 1991 with A-levels in mathematics, further mathematics, chemistry and biology and graduated from Warwick University with a BSc in mathematics in 1995.  He joined the graduate training programme of Morgan Grenfell & Co, initially working as a quantitative analyst in the Risk department.  Following acquisition by Deutsche Bank he subsequently joined the Markets division and has traded hybrid and exotic derivatives in Commodities (including weather), Foreign Exchange and Credit in London, New York and Singapore.  More recently he has overseen risk and capital management in the Corporate Bank, been the General Manager of the bank’s nearshore centre in Birmingham and been global chief operating officer for Sales.  Currently he is Global Head of Listed Derivatives and Clearing, based in London, a position he has held since 2019.
